DF Motor DF150-2 Cruiser 2007 - Specifications & Review

DF150-2 Cruiser

Article Complete Info

Articleid650076
CategoryCustom-cruiser
MakeDF Motor
ModelDF150-2 Cruiser
Year2007

Chassis, Suspension, Brakes & Wheels

FrontbrakesSingle disc
FrontsuspensionTelescopic
Fronttyre10/90-16
RearbrakesExpanding brake (drum brake)
RearsuspensionSwing Arm
Reartyre130/90-16

Engine & Transmission

Displacement149.50 ccm (9.12 cubic inches)
EnginedetailsSingle cylinder, four-stroke
FuelsystemCarburettor
Power10.99 HP (8.0 kW)) @ 8000 RPM
Topspeed90.0 km/h (55.9 mph)
TransmissiontypefinaldriveBelt

Other Specifications

ColoroptionsBlack
CommentsChinese cruiser.
StarterKick

Physical Measures & Capacities

Dryweight142.0 kg (313.1 pounds)
Powerweightratio0.0774 HP/kg
Weightincloilgasetc159.0 kg (350.5 pounds)

About DF Motor DF150-2 Cruiser 2007

Introducing the 2007 DF Motor DF150-2 Cruiser, a motorcycle that encapsulates the spirit of classic cruising with a modern twist. Positioned in the custom-cruiser category, this machine is an entry-level gem that appeals to both new riders and seasoned enthusiasts looking for a budget-friendly option. With its sleek design and approachable ergonomics, the DF150-2 is perfect for those who enjoy the open road, urban commuting, or leisurely weekend rides. It’s a testament to DF Motor's commitment to delivering a unique riding experience without breaking the bank.

At the heart of the DF150-2 is a spirited single-cylinder, four-stroke engine boasting a displacement of 149.5 ccm. With a power output of 10.99 HP at 8000 RPM, this cruiser is designed for smooth, responsive handling rather than high-octane thrills. Riders can reach a top speed of 90 km/h (55.9 mph), making it ideal for city streets and scenic highways alike. The carburettor fuel system ensures simplicity and ease of maintenance, while the belt final drive contributes to a quieter ride. The lightweight design, tipping the scales at just 142 kg (313.1 pounds), enhances maneuverability, allowing riders to navigate tight corners with confidence.

The DF150-2 Cruiser offers an array of features that enhance both comfort and style. The telescopic front suspension and swing arm rear suspension work in tandem to provide a smooth ride, absorbing bumps and imperfections in the road. Stopping power is handled by a reliable single disc brake at the front and an expanding drum brake at the rear, ensuring you can confidently come to a halt when needed. With classic black color options, this motorcycle not only performs well but also presents a timeless aesthetic appeal. The kick starter adds a nostalgic touch, harkening back to the days of simpler machines, inviting riders to become one with their bike.

PROs:

  1. Affordable Entry-Level Cruiser: Ideal for both new riders and budget-conscious enthusiasts, making it an accessible choice in the cruiser market.
  2. Lightweight Design: At just 142 kg (313.1 pounds), the bike’s agility allows for easy maneuverability and comfort in urban settings.
  3. Simple Maintenance: The carburettor fuel system and kick starter ensure that upkeep is straightforward, perfect for DIY enthusiasts.

CONs:

  1. Limited Power Output: With only 10.99 HP, it may not satisfy riders looking for high-performance thrills on highways.
  2. Basic Braking System: The combination of a single disc brake at the front and a drum brake at the rear may not provide the stopping power seen in more advanced models.
  3. Nostalgic Features: While the kick starter adds charm, it may not appeal to riders who prefer the convenience of electric starting systems.

The 2007 DF Motor DF150-2 Cruiser stands as a solid choice for those who cherish the essence of cruising without the complexities and costs associated with larger motorcycles.
